用JS打破平等高度列的图像

时间:2011-06-12 21:21:47

标签: javascript jquery json tumblr

看起来我的问题永远不会以此网站结束。我正在使用jQuery将标记为“_featured”的帖子拖到Tumblr博客的侧边栏中。我有它调用文本帖子的标题以及其中包含的图像。不幸的是,无论我尝试什么,这都会打破内容列不长于侧边栏的任何页面上的相等高度列。

我尝试了不同的方法来实现相等的列(我现在正在使用The Equal Heights jQuery Plugin,因为我已经在网站上使用了jQuery。我也尝试了填充/负边距技巧和良好的ol'使用背景图像的Faux Equal Columns。我想通过使用jQuery插件并将函数调用包装在$(window).load(function()中来解决它很容易,但它仍然是命中或错过(大多数是错过了)现在出于某种原因)。

如果有人有任何建议,请保存我的计算机。我认为可能有效的明显解决方案是让JS调用特色帖子也包括图像大小,但我不知道我会怎么做。

可以查看调用特色帖子的JS here,网站本身位于escapebadmusic.com

再次感谢大家。我想我每次发帖都这么说,但这里的帮助为我节省了很多时间和挫折。总是很感激。

1 个答案:

答案 0 :(得分:0)

在dom完成更改后尝试运行EqualHeights。 (更具体一点 - 您应该在添加图像后在doc.ready,之后运行EqualHeights,或者更改影响高度的dom中的任何内容)